Guys, if you plan to head for Stelvio again this Summer, then it's definitely worth considering to extend the trip a bit further down South the Dolomites for a Garda Lake round trip (pre-Alps - Northern Italy). You're in the area anyway with your cars, so benefit from that unique occasion. Will be a fond memory for future story-telling. Our non-European forum fellows must eat their hearts out that we can manage to roam the roads and towns at that exquisite location.

It normally takes about 2.5 hours to get from Stelvio to Trento (160 km) (Northern Italy) by car. Then heading (with a full fuel tank) from Trento southwestwards towards Sarche (for a stop at the lovely Castel Toblino bar/restaurant - an extraordinary scenic location to have a drink or get some food), further southwards towards Riva del Garda (Northern point of the Garda Lake). Then start the Garda Lake round trip anti-clockwise: at Riva del Garda take the westside leg southwards towards Peschiera del Garda (Southern point of the Garda Lake). Subsequently take the eastside leg northwards (other half). Should you want to skip the eastside leg (in the unlikely event of bad weather, lack of time, feeling tired or road too crowded), you can decide to take the highway at Peschiera del Garda either heading West (direction of Milan) or East (direction of Verona / Padova / Venice) or back North (direction of Trento / Bolzano / Innsbruck).

If the Garda Lake round trip is too loaded to combine in one day with the Stelvio as schedule, then spend a night in the Trento whereabouts and schedule the next day for the Garda Lake round trip. Eventually you can have dinner in the Northern area of the Garda Lake and get back to the Trento whereabouts for spending a second night. Next morning with fresh energy the return trip: heading North (highway) from Trento towards the Austrian border (± 150 km), across Austria and subsequently the German Autobahn again.

On a sunny day touring around the Garda Lake is truly a joy for all senses. Scenic, curving lake roads with plenty of small tunnels (vroom-vroom ). Even if temperatures are high (normally 30-35°C in the Summer season), you still got the lake breeze. During the weekend the road can be pretty crowded, as you may expect.
